Forget the bucket and sponge method. A foam sprayer, or foam cannon, attaches to your pressure washer or garden hose and creates a thick, clinging layer of suds. This foam works to lift and encapsulate dirt, grime, and road film, allowing it to slide off the surface without abrasive scrubbing. This not only saves you time and effort but is also the safest way to wash your car’s paint, minimizing the risk of swirl marks and scratches.
Not all foam cannons are created equal. When searching for the best car detailing tools, consider these essential features:
Adjustable Foam Density: Control the thickness of the foam from a light mist to a shaving-cream-like consistency.
Durable Construction: Look for metal fittings and brass nozzles for longevity, not cheap plastic.
Compatibility: Ensure the sprayer fits your specific pressure washer model or hose connection.
1.1mm Orifice Nozzle: This is often the ideal size for creating rich, thick foam with most residential pressure washers.

To get the most out of your foam sprayer, follow these car washing hacks:
• Use Warm Water: Warm water in the foam cannon bottle helps soap activate better.
• Quality Soap is Key: Invest in a dedicated pH-neutral car shampoo designed for foam cannons.
• The “Dwell Time” Rule: After applying foam, let it sit and “dwell” on the paint for 3-5 minutes to loosen dirt, but don’t let it dry.
